Abstract
A mobile terminal having a function of measuring biometric signals from a user is provided. The mobile terminal includes a main body and a display, which is formed at a front of the main body and configured to display information to a user. The display includes a measurement area configured to measure biometric signals from the user. A pixel structure formed in the measurement area of the display includes red (R) sub-pixels configured to generate R light, and infrared (IR) sub-pixels configured to generate IR light. The measurement area of the display includes a light-receiver, which receives light reflected from the body of the user. The mobile terminal is configured to measure at least one of a photoplethysmogram (PPG) signal and an oxygen saturation (SpO2) signal through the measurement area.

8. A mobile terminal having a function of measuring biometric signals of a user, comprising:
-
a main body; an ECG sensor including a first electrode formed in a home button provided in the main body, and a second electrode formed in a portion of the main body where the home button is not provided; and a PPG sensor formed in a portion of the main body where the first or second electrode is formed and having a light-emitter configured to generate light to be irradiated to the body of the user, and a light-receiver configured to receive light reflected from the body of the user, wherein at least one of an ECG signal, a PPG signal, and a SpO2 signal is measured using at least one of the ECG sensor and the PPG sensor. - View Dependent Claims (9, 10, 11, 12, 13, 14, 15)
